The Uttarakhand government has recommended a CBI inquiry into the high-profile Ankita Bhadari case. Uttarakhand Chief Minister Pushkar Singh Dhami said that the decision has been taken in response to the request of Ankita’s parents.
The Chief Minister stated that the government’s objective has been to ensure justice throughout the process in a fair, transparent, and sensitive manner. He reiterated his firm and sensitive commitment to securing justice for Ankita Bhandari, stressing that no fact or evidence will be ignored.
It may be recalled that after the case came to light in 2022, an SIT led by a woman IPS officer was constituted, all the accused were arrested, and strong legal representation ensured that no bail was granted. After the investigation, a charge sheet was filed, and the lower court sentenced the accused to life imprisonment.
